Introduction
MSc. Chemical Engineer with expertise in the synthesis of micro- and mesoporous-based catalysts; characterization of catalytic materials using various techniques such as XRD, physisorption, TEM-EDX, SEM-EDX, NH3-TPD, CO2-TPD, Pyr-FTIR, XPS, TPO-MS, NMR, UV-Vis-DR; chemical reactions engineering; kinetic modeling; Life Cycle Assessment (LCA). Proficiency in using Matlab, Scilab, and Aspen Plus software for chemical process simulation, as well as Umberto and SimaPro software for LCA studies.
